Artists, as I'm sure you are aware, you are held to a higher standard than most other gallery sites. Just to clarify some differences:
- This site is for original art of an illustrative nature.
- Sketches are quite welcome. We love sketches! You should too.
- 3D works of art such as sculpture, murals, outdoor art, etc. are allowed. Please do try to use the same thought of composition and lighting as you would for a 2D piece. No quick snapshots with a simple flash. This forum topic covers one way to properly light a sculpture.
- Costumes, like fursuits, while technically 3D art, inherently cannot demonstrate two of the four fundamentals in our guidelines. There might be an exception here and there, but it would have to be part of a scene as well thought out as a movie cinematographer might compose. In other words, entirely judged on lighting and composition—we will expect it to look like a still from a well-produced major motion picture.
- Fan art is allowed in small quantities. We encourage original art, but do realize that inspiration can come from existing works.
- We highly value your own interpretations of characters. This is easier to do with fictional characters from books versus a movie, but can still be done. If your art is based on visually recognizable characters, such as those from an animated movie, try it in a different style! Or, do a situation that fits the characters, but does not imitate a scene. We are all creative people, lets think of something the original creators didn't.
- We reserve the right to remove fan art if there is too much of it in a gallery, but will notify the artist beforehand to alert them to the situation.
- If the property's owner or company asks us to remove specific art of an existing character, we will do so.
- Photos are only allowed if they are of original art (see 3D works above).
- The art you upload must be created by you.
- The art must fall within our ratings, G thru PG-13.
- If you upload older works, please use the backdating creation date feature when uploading. This site aims to be a gallery site, and newer works are encouraged, from doodles to finished pieces.
- Blatant kink-only pieces are not allowed on ArtSpots due to the broad base of users of all ages. If you are going to sneak a piece in because of the tame nature, make it exceptional in creativity and story. Don't bore us.
- Respect copyright.
- Large watermarks that disrupt the viewing of an image (copyright notices, artist logos, etc.) are not allowed. Such things should be off to one side or corner. Images should not be at a sufficient size to duplicate anyway (see below).
- No monstrous images. Keep images at a reasonable (screen-viewable) size.
- Rate pictures appropriately.
These apply to everyone who visits the site:
- Description and comment language should fit the rating of the image. No swearing in G rated pictures, for example.
- Don't make defamatory or insulting comments.
- Above all, to mark us as kids from the 80's, be excellent to each other.
If these are obviously ignored repeated times or after warnings, we will take action. This list can change, so check back from time to time. If you're unsure of anything, please ask us.
